David Anderson has gone a perfect 8-0 against Leetonia recently and they'll look to pad the win column further on Monday. The Blue Devils will be playing in front of their home fans against the Bears at 5:00 p.m. David Anderson is strutting in with some hitting muscle as they've averaged 7 runs per game this season.
On Tuesday, David Anderson didn't have quite enough to beat Lowellville and fell 8-7.
Kamryn Peruchetti sp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ered five earned (and three unearned) runs on 12 hits and racked up seven Ks. She has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't given up more than one walk in five consecutive appearances.
At the plate, Abby Ammon was cooking despite her team's loss, going 2-for-4 with two runs, one triple, and two RBI. Another player making a difference was Delaney Pickens, who went 2-for-4 with two runs, two doubles, and two RBI.
Meanwhile, Leetonia lost 12-1 to Columbiana on Monday. The Bears have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
David Anderson's loss dropped their record down to 5-12. As for Leetonia, their defeat dropped their record down to 1-17.
Everything went David Anderson's way against Leetonia in their previous matchup back in May of 2024, as David Anderson made off with a 26-1 victory. Will the Blue Devils repeat their success, or do the Bears have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
